What was the Treaty of Tordesillas and how did it relate to Magellan's voyage?
The Treaty of Tordesillas was an agreement between Spain and Portugal, signed in 1494, which divided the newly discovered lands outside Europe between the two empires along a meridian 370 leagues west of the Cape Verde islands. Although it predated Magellan's voyage, this treaty influenced his journey as it delineated areas of exploration and influence for the Spanish and Portuguese crowns, allowing Magellan, sailing for Spain, to seek a western route to the Spice Islands.
